The Omega Seamaster Professional Diver 300M. The name itself evokes images of underwater exploration, rugged durability, and timeless elegance. First introduced in 1993, this iconic timepiece hasn't just survived; it's thrived, becoming a staple in the world of luxury watches and a favorite among divers and collectors alike. Its enduring popularity stems from a perfect blend of robust functionality, sophisticated design, and a rich history intertwined with James Bond himself. A Legacy Forged in the Depths:

The Seamaster Professional Diver 300M wasn't born overnight. Omega's history with diving watches stretches back decades, with various models preceding the iconic 300M. However, 1993 marked a pivotal moment. The 300M, with its distinctive design and superior technical specifications, solidified Omega's position as a leading manufacturer of professional diving watches. The watch quickly gained a reputation for its reliability, precision, and resistance to the harsh conditions encountered underwater. Its 300-meter water resistance (hence the "300M" designation) ensured it could withstand the pressures of deep dives, while its robust construction guaranteed longevity even in the most demanding environments.

The immediate success of the Seamaster Professional Diver 300M wasn't solely based on its technical prowess. Its aesthetically pleasing design also played a crucial role. The combination of a unidirectional rotating bezel, easily legible dial, and comfortable bracelet made it both functional and stylish. This blend of form and function has been a key ingredient in its enduring appeal, making it a desirable timepiece for both professional divers and watch enthusiasts who appreciate a classic design.

Key Features & Variations:

Over the years, Omega has released numerous variations of the Seamaster Professional Diver 300M, each building upon the original's success while incorporating modern advancements in watchmaking technology. Some key features that have remained consistent across generations include:

* Helium Escape Valve: Essential for professional saturation divers, this valve allows helium gas to escape during decompression, preventing the watch crystal from imploding.

* Unidirectional Rotating Bezel: This bezel, which rotates only counter-clockwise, helps divers accurately track their dive time.

* Screw-Down Crown: This securely seals the crown, ensuring water resistance.

* Luminous Hands and Markers: Ensuring excellent legibility in low-light conditions, crucial for underwater visibility.

* Sapphire Crystal: Highly scratch-resistant and transparent, this crystal protects the watch face.

Variations in the Seamaster Professional Diver 300M range from subtle differences in dial color and bracelet material to significant changes in movement and case size. Some popular variations include models featuring ceramic bezels, various dial colors (black, blue, silver, etc.), and different bracelet options (stainless steel, rubber, titanium). These variations cater to a wide range of preferences and styles, making it possible for everyone to find a Seamaster Professional that suits their individual tastes. The introduction of co-axial movements further enhanced the precision and longevity of the watch.
